Pros
- Operates a regional banking franchise in Texas with a long-established presence and a diversified loan portfolio across commercial, agricultural, and consumer segments.
- Maintains a reputation for financial stability, with a conservative balance sheet and consistent profitability through economic cycles.
- Expands services through digital banking, trust, and wealth management, positioning to capture more customer wallet share in its core markets.
Considerations
- Faces concentration risk with operations and loans primarily in Texas, exposing it to regional economic cycles and commodity price volatility.
- Valuation metrics such as price-to-earnings and price-to-book ratios are elevated compared to sector peers, potentially limiting upside for new investors.
- Revenue growth may be constrained by limited geographic diversification and heightened competition in the crowded Texas banking market.

F&G
FG
Pros
- Specialises in annuity and life insurance products, sectors benefiting from aging demographics and increased demand for retirement income solutions.
- Exhibits strong underwriting capabilities and efficient product distribution through independent channels, supporting margin resilience.
- Recent regulatory approvals and product launches suggest capacity for innovation and adaptation in a changing insurance landscape.
Considerations
- Heavily reliant on interest-sensitive products, making earnings vulnerable to shifts in monetary policy and prolonged low-rate environments.
- Expansion into new products and markets introduces execution risk, including potential mispricing or claims volatility.
- Intense competition from larger, diversified insurers may pressure pricing and limit market share gains.
